Enter your average income below to estimate applicable free-cash in all major European cities. By free-cash we mean your disposable income, left in your pocket after paying tax, rent, insurance, public transport, food expenses and basic entertainment. How does it work?

As of 1 January, 2018 a microenterprise tax rate for microenterprise turnover of up to €40,000 is 15%. This tax is inclusive of all other taxes and contributions.

Microenterprise tax could also be applied to a company but as the only exception is a limitation of liability, we advise to register as a sole-trader.

Corporate income tax rate is 20% applicable to the taxable base. However, before applying the statutory rate, the taxable base should be divided by a coefficient of 0.8. As taxable base is increased by the coefficient, the effective corporate income tax rate is 25%.

The only visa which will gain you entry to the UK as a freelancer is Tier 1 (with an exception of EU nationals or long-term UK residence permit holders, up until Brexit). There are two Tier 1 visa pathways.

You can either apply for an Entrepreneur visa which requires an investment of at least £200000 and creating two full time jobs, or choose an Exceptional Talent visa, which has no financial requirements but is more difficult to obtain.

As a Third Country National (non-EU/EFTA/Swiss and without a long-term EU resident permit), you can apply for permanent residence when your business creates macroeconomic benefit. This could be an investment starting from €100,000, creating new jobs or securing existing ones, or making a substantial contribution to the region's economy. You can also be considered with a transfer of know-how to Austria or an evident commitment to develop an innovative product or technology.

By law (Article 9 §1 (7); Article 10 §1 (7); Article 11 §1 (5)) a social contribution base is set as:

  • up to €9,000.00, 60% of the average monthly wage in Montenegro
  • up to €15,000.00, 100% of the average monthly wage in Montenegro
  • in excess of €15,000, 150% of the average monthly wage in Montenegro
